Self Clean Mode

Airborne bacteria can grow in the moisture that condenses around

the unit’s heat exchanger. With regular use, most of this moisture is

evaporated from the unit. 
Press 

SET

 

 until the 

SELF CLEAN

 icon is displayed on the

remote control, then push Up or Down to activate. Under this

function, the air conditioner automatically cleans and dries the

evaporator coil. The cleaning cycle takes 30 minutes, after which the

unit turns off automatically. 
Press 

SLC

 on the middle of the cycle to cancel the operation and

turn the unit off. This function can be activated only on 

COOL

 or

DRY

 mode.

Follow Me Mode

Press 

SET

 

 until the 

FOLLOW ME

 icon appears on the remote

control, then push and to activate or deactivate this function.
Under this setting, the temperature that appears in the remote
control is the actual temperature at its location.
The remote control sends this signal to the air conditioner every 3
minutes. This function is not available for 

DRY

 and 

FAN

 modes.

This function can also be deactivated if:

1. No 

FOLLOW ME

 signal is received by the unit for continuous 7

minutes.

2. Users adjust the operation mode
3. Users turn off the unit
4. Users turn off the 

FOLLOW ME

 function

NOTE: If FOLLOW ME is used with the wireless remote

controller, ensure that the remote’s IR sender is within

line-of-sight of the IR receiver of the unit and is within the

maximum range of 25 feet of the indoor unit. If FOLLOW

ME is de-activated by pressing MODE, OFF or

FOLLOW ME on the remote, the icon on the remote will

turn off.

Silence Mode

Hold down 

Fan

 

Speed

 button (-) for 2 seconds to activate or

deactivate the 

SILENCE

 Mode. Under this function, the

compressor operates at low frequency and the indoor unit produces a

faint breeze, which reduces the noise to the lowest level. Due to low

the frequency operation of the compressor, it may result in

insufficient cooling and heating capacity.

Resetting the Remote Control

If the batteries in the remote control are removed, the current

settings will be canceled and the control returns to the initial settings
and will be in standby mode. Push 

ON/OFF

 to activate.

Time Delay

If 

ON/OFF

 is pressed too soon after a stop, the compressor will not

start for 3 to 4 minutes due to the inherent protection against
frequent compressor cycling. The unit only emits an audible beep
when the signals are received correctly.

Heating Features

If the unit is in the 

HEATING

 mode, there is a delay when the fan

starts. The fan starts only after the coil is warmed up to prevent cold
blow.

Auto Defrost Operation

In the 

HEATING

 mode, if the outdoor coil is frosted, the indoor fan

and outdoor fan turns off while the system removes the frost on the
outdoor coil. The system automatically reverts to normal operation
when frost is removed from the outdoor unit.

Auto Start

If the power fails while the unit is operating, the unit stores the
operating condition, and it will start operation automatically under
those conditions when the power is restored.

Refrigerant Leakage Detection

The indoor unit displays “EC” when it detects a refrigerant leak.
